Stubbs the Zombie: Rebel Without a Pulse Now Available For Free

Originally released for the Xbox in 2005, Stubbs the Zombie in Rebel Without a Pulse made news because it was a creative action game from the same minds that originally worked on Halo. In case you missed it back then, GameAgent is currently running a promotion on the downloadable PC version of the game – they're giving it away completely FREE of charge.
